Xanthogranulomatous Pyelonephritis
Xanthogranulomatous pyelonephritis is an uncommon form of chronic kidney infection that causes prolonged inflammation and progressive damage to the kidney tissue. It is usually associated with obstructions, such as stones, and urinary tract infections that do not resolve.
Common symptoms:
- Pain in the lower back or flank.
- Persistent fever and general malaise.
- Repeated urinary tract infections.
When to see a doctor? With lower back pain accompanied by fever or recurring urinary tract infections, an evaluation is advisable to identify the cause.
